ET LFT8 owners...
Posted by Mr_bill2 on February 17, 2012 at 13:32:14:
have you tightened your screws lately?
It's been about 4 yrs since I set up my 8s and I just by chance today noticed I had a little play(movement) where the planar panel attaches to the woofer box on one of my speakers, so I grabbed the tool box and went in to investigate. Well to my surprised I find all 11 screws that attach the speaker panel, woofer box and stand together were all loose!
Pretty unbelievable as I know I tightened them down snug when I assembled them back when. I also found the same on the other speaker as well.
Well, after about 10 minutes worth of tightening, I can't believe how much more focused the sound is(must be the effect is so slow over time that I had no idea what I was losing). But I still can't believe over time they loosen up that much and the negative effects it had on the sound, really blows my mind.
So FWIW guys, have you checked your speaker screws lately, you might be as surprised as I was. Happy screwing!! ;)
